Section 3: Tech Gadgets for Dog Care

Harnessing Technology for Enhanced Dog Care

The realm of dog care has been significantly transformed by technological advancements, and 2024 showcases some of the most innovative and practical gadgets designed to make pet care more efficient and effective. These tech gadgets not only simplify routine care tasks but also bring a new level of sophistication to monitoring and improving the health and safety of our canine companions.

Automatic Feeders: Convenience Meets Nutrition

Automatic feeders are a standout in this category, offering a perfect solution for busy pet owners. These devices can be programmed to dispense food at specific times, ensuring that dogs are fed regularly even when their owners are away. Advanced models come with features like portion control, which is especially beneficial for dogs on a strict diet. Some even have smartphone connectivity, allowing owners to feed their pets remotely and monitor their eating habits.

GPS Trackers: Keeping Tabs on the Adventurous Pooch

For the adventurous or escape-prone dog, GPS trackers are a godsend. These compact devices can be attached to a dog’s collar, providing real-time location tracking. Whether you're at work or on vacation, a GPS tracker gives you the peace of mind that comes with knowing your dog's whereabouts. Many of these trackers also include geofencing capabilities, alerting owners if their pet strays beyond a designated area.

Health Monitoring Devices: A Step Towards Proactive Care

Perhaps the most impactful technological advancement in dog care is the development of health monitoring devices. These gadgets range from smart collars with built-in health sensors to standalone monitoring devices that track vital signs like heart rate and body temperature. They can detect early signs of illness or distress, enabling proactive care and potentially saving lives. The data collected by these devices can also be shared with veterinarians for a more comprehensive understanding of a dog's health.

Section 5: Fun and Interactive Dog Toys

Engaging Playtime: The World of Interactive Dog Toys

In the dynamic world of pet care, dog toys have evolved to become more than just playthings; they are essential tools for enriching a dog's life. Interactive toys, in particular, have gained immense popularity for their ability to engage dogs both physically and mentally. As we head into 2024, a variety of innovative and stimulating toys have captured the attention of dog owners, offering new ways to keep their canine friends entertained, active, and intellectually stimulated.

  1. Puzzle Feeders and Treat-Dispensing Toys: These toys are designed to challenge a dog’s problem-solving skills, keeping their minds active while rewarding them with treats. Examples include complex puzzle boxes, interactive balls that release kibble as they roll, and toys that require manipulation to access the treats.
  2. Tug and Fetch Toys with a Twist: Traditional games of tug and fetch are given an innovative update. Durable rubber toys, frisbees with unique designs, and automated ball launchers that allow dogs to play fetch even when their owners are busy are among the favorites.
  3. Squeaky and Plush Toys with Hidden Features: These toys often come with hidden puzzles or compartments, adding an element of surprise and curiosity to a dog’s playtime. They are perfect for sensory engagement and keeping dogs intrigued for longer periods.
  4. Smart Interactive Toys: Technology has made its way into dog toys as well, with app-controlled gadgets that can simulate various movements and sounds to engage a dog's natural hunting instincts. Some even allow remote interaction, letting owners play with their pets from anywhere.
  5. Chew Toys for Dental Health: Durable chew toys designed to improve dental health while providing entertainment. These toys are often made of safe, chew-resistant materials and can help in cleaning teeth and massaging gums.

The Role of Toys in a Dog’s Well-being

The importance of toys in a dog’s life extends beyond mere entertainment. They play a crucial role in ensuring a dog's physical and mental well-being. Physically, toys encourage exercise, which is vital for maintaining a healthy weight and cardiovascular health. Mentally, interactive toys provide cognitive stimulation, helping to keep a dog's brain sharp and preventing boredom, which can lead to destructive behaviors.

Moreover, toys can be instrumental in reinforcing training and building a stronger bond between dogs and their owners. They serve as tools for socialization, especially in puppies, teaching them appropriate play behavior and how to interact with humans and other dogs.

Section 6: Health and Wellness Products for Dogs

Prioritizing Canine Health and Comfort

The health and well-being of our canine companions are paramount, and the market for dog health and wellness products in 2024 reflects this priority. From dietary supplements to grooming essentials and organic treats, there are numerous products designed to enhance the health, comfort, and quality of life of dogs. Making informed choices in this realm not only contributes to the physical well-being of our pets but also to their overall happiness and longevity.

Choosing the Right Supplements

  1. Joint Health Supplements: As dogs age, their joints may need extra support. Supplements containing glucosamine, chondroitin, and MSM can help maintain joint health and mobility.
  2. Skin and Coat Supplements: Products rich in omega fatty acids, like fish oil supplements, are great for maintaining a healthy skin and shiny coat, reducing shedding and improving overall skin health.
  3. Digestive Aids: Probiotics and prebiotics are crucial for maintaining gut health, aiding in digestion, and ensuring proper nutrient absorption.
  4. Immune System Boosters: Supplements with antioxidants and vitamins can bolster a dog's immune system, especially important for puppies and senior dogs.

Grooming Tools for Health and Comfort

  1. Brushes and Combs: Regular brushing helps to remove loose fur, prevent matting, and distribute natural oils through the coat. Selecting the right type of brush or comb for your dog's coat type is essential.
  2. Nail Clippers and Grinders: Keeping nails trimmed is vital for a dog's posture and joint health. Ergonomic clippers or electric grinders can make the process smoother.
  3. Dental Care Tools: Oral hygiene products like toothbrushes, dental chews, and water additives can significantly impact a dog's dental health and prevent related diseases.

Organic and Natural Treats

  1. All-Natural Ingredients: Treats made from organic, non-GMO ingredients are a healthier option, free from artificial additives and harmful chemicals.
  2. Functional Treats: Many treats now come with added benefits like dental health, joint support, or calming ingredients like chamomile and L-theanine.
  3. Special Dietary Needs: Treats catering to specific dietary requirements, such as grain-free, limited ingredient, or hypoallergenic options, are also important for dogs with sensitivities or allergies.

The Significance of Health and Wellness Products

Investing in health and wellness products is an investment in your dog’s overall well-being. These products not only address specific health concerns but also contribute to a dog's daily comfort and happiness. It's essential to choose products that are appropriate for your dog's age, breed, and health status, and when in doubt, consulting with a veterinarian can provide valuable guidance.

Section 8: Outdoor and Travel Gear for Dogs

Gear Up for Adventure: Essentials for the Travel-Savvy Dog and Owner

For the adventurous dog and owner duo, the right gear can make all the difference in ensuring a fun, safe, and comfortable experience. Whether it's a hike in the mountains, a day at the beach, or a cross-country road trip, 2024 offers an array of outdoor and travel gear designed specifically for dogs. These items not only cater to the practical aspects of traveling with a pet but also enhance the overall experience, making every adventure a memorable one.

Must-Have Outdoor and Travel Items

  1. Travel Bowls and Water Dispensers: Compact and collapsible bowls are essential for hydrating and feeding your dog on the go. Portable water dispensers, which often come with attached drinking cups, are convenient for ensuring your dog stays hydrated during long walks or hikes.
  2. Dog Carriers and Backpacks: For smaller dogs or long journeys, a comfortable and secure dog carrier is crucial. Backpack-style carriers are a great option for hiking, allowing hands-free mobility while keeping your dog close and comfortable.
  3. All-Terrain Harnesses and Leashes: Durable harnesses and leashes designed for outdoor activities provide added safety and control. Look for features like reflective material for visibility and weather-resistant fabrics.
  4. Protective Gear: Depending on the environment, protective gear such as booties for rough terrain, life jackets for water activities, or cooling vests for hot climates can be vital for your dog’s safety and comfort.
  5. Portable Beds and Tents: For overnight trips, portable dog beds or tents provide a cozy and familiar space for your dog to rest, ensuring they get the sleep they need after a day of adventure.
  6. First-Aid Kits for Dogs: A dog-specific first-aid kit is a must-have for any outdoor excursion. It should include items like bandages, antiseptic wipes, tick removers, and any medication your dog may need.
